Output 4bed543f11b38dc59401075e46cf5705d1df4b701c782e256f71ed30d626eb12:1

value
44946294
script pubkey
OP_0 OP_PUSHBYTES_20 31cb2201534beff35540db66f7008f3759de432a
address
bc1qx89jyq2nf0hlx42qmdn0wqy0xavause2p56agx
transaction
4bed543f11b38dc59401075e46cf5705d1df4b701c782e256f71ed30d626eb12
confirmations
58020
spent
true